I know this is hitting site but would like to throw out a situation to good coaches on a play my staff can't agree on.here it is:runners on 1st and 3rd,less than 2 outs ,ball popped up down 1st base line 60-80 feet and lets say it well be caught in foul territory.On this play1st,2nd,and right fielder go after the ball.How would you defense it.

You say the ball is going to be caught. Do the players know this? If they know it's going to be caught the only exposure is 2nd base and the shortstop should be there. There may be an opportunity to double off the 1st base runner if he takes off for second. No one there. Pitcher has to back up home plate in case there is a play there. Too important to keep runner on 1st from advancing further if there is an overthrow at the plate. Therefore you could have 3rd base cover 2nd and ss cover 1st however, not likely for them io identify the siutation immediately and you may not want this if the ball is not caught. I'd play it safe and protect 2nd with shortstop, 3rd with 3rd baseman, and let pitcher back up home plate. This allows runner on 1st too much freedom but I don't like the downside of other defense options.
